How Ideal Protein Works
The body draws from three sources of energy: carbohydrates, muscle and fats, always drawing from carbohydrates first. The Ideal Protein weight loss method limits the carbohydrate intake during the first phase, forcing the body to turn to fat and muscle for energy. By focusing on consuming high-biological protein foods, we protect lean muscle mass, allowing the body to burn fat for energy.
Many chronic diseases are associated with obesity. Losing weight can help ease the symptoms and reduce risk factors for many of these diseases, including:
- GERD/Heartburn
- Asthma
- High Cholesterol
- High blood pressure
- Type II diabetes
- Stroke
- Gallbladder disease
- Osteoarthritis
- Sleep apnea and other breathing problems
- Mental health problems (depression, low self-esteem, etc.)
The Four Phases
Phase I: to be followed until 100% of your weight loss goal is achieved.
Three Ideal Protein packets/day, plus
- Vegetables
- Unlimited lettuce
- Dinner meat of your choice*
Example of daily menu
- Breakfast: Ideal Protein Fine Herbs & Cheese omelet
- Lunch: Ideal Protein Tomato & Basil soup with vegetables and lettuce
- Dinner: Chicken breast with vegetables and lettuce
- Daily Snack: Ideal Protein Dill Pickle Zipper
Phase II:To be followed for two weeks
Two Ideal Protein packets/day, plus
- Vegetables
- Unlimited lettuce
- Dinner meat of your choice*
Phase III: is a 14-day gradual reintroduction of healthy carbohydrates and fats in the morning only. Lunch and dinner options remain the same.
Phase IV: is a maintenance plan, designed to help keep you at your goal weight and is based on a few simple principles.
